Lines Matching refs:sps
2284 static void kvmppc_add_seg_page_size(struct kvm_ppc_one_seg_page_size **sps, in kvmppc_add_seg_page_size() argument
2291 (*sps)->page_shift = def->shift; in kvmppc_add_seg_page_size()
2292 (*sps)->slb_enc = def->sllp; in kvmppc_add_seg_page_size()
2293 (*sps)->enc[0].page_shift = def->shift; in kvmppc_add_seg_page_size()
2294 (*sps)->enc[0].pte_enc = def->penc[linux_psize]; in kvmppc_add_seg_page_size()
2299 (*sps)->enc[1].page_shift = 24; in kvmppc_add_seg_page_size()
2300 (*sps)->enc[1].pte_enc = def->penc[MMU_PAGE_16M]; in kvmppc_add_seg_page_size()
2302 (*sps)++; in kvmppc_add_seg_page_size()
2308 struct kvm_ppc_one_seg_page_size *sps; in kvm_vm_ioctl_get_smmu_info_hv() local
2316 sps = &info->sps[0]; in kvm_vm_ioctl_get_smmu_info_hv()
2317 kvmppc_add_seg_page_size(&sps, MMU_PAGE_4K); in kvm_vm_ioctl_get_smmu_info_hv()
2318 kvmppc_add_seg_page_size(&sps, MMU_PAGE_64K); in kvm_vm_ioctl_get_smmu_info_hv()
2319 kvmppc_add_seg_page_size(&sps, MMU_PAGE_16M); in kvm_vm_ioctl_get_smmu_info_hv()